
nLight (NASDAQ:LASR) reported record second-quarter revenue and product sales as demand increased across its defense, space and advanced-manufacturing markets, while management said supply-chain constraints involving materials sourced from China are expected to reduce third-quarter shipments.
Second-quarter revenue rose 34% year over year to $82.6 million, including record product revenue of $59 million, up 45%. Chairman and CEO Scott Keeney said revenue, gross margin and adjusted EBITDA were at or above the company’s expectations. Adjusted EBITDA totaled $10.7 million, compared with $5.6 million a year earlier, while operating cash flow reached a record $20.7 million.
Defense Revenue Sets Record
Aerospace and defense revenue reached a record $57.3 million in the quarter, up 41% from the prior-year period. Aerospace and defense product revenue increased 72% year over year, while development revenue rose 11% to $23.2 million.
Chief Financial Officer Joe Corso said the growth reflected continued work on the HELSI-2 program, expansion in munitions programs, and execution on directed-energy and laser-sensing programs. The company also said its products for kinetic weapons recorded strong growth, supported by global restocking activity and expanding mission applications.
The company highlighted its recent Joint Laser Weapon System, or JLWS, award from the Department of War. The multiyear agreement has a contract ceiling of more than $600 million. Under the program, nLight is expected to develop, integrate and deliver high-energy laser weapon systems built on its HADES directed-energy technology platform.
Keeney said the JLWS program builds on the company’s delivery of a 300-kilowatt laser under HELSI-1 and a 50-kilowatt laser for the DE M-SHORAD program. nLight is also continuing work on a 1-megawatt coherent beam-combined laser under HELSI-2, which Corso said remains on track for delivery late in 2026.
Corso said JLWS revenue will begin contributing in the third quarter, continue through the fourth quarter and ramp more substantially in 2027. He characterized the expected JLWS contribution as “a nice replacement and then some” relative to the anticipated wind-down of HELSI-2 work.
Management said JLWS and HELSI-2 are separate contracts. The company also said initial JLWS work, including work beyond the initially funded $44 million, is expected to be largely unaffected by current supply-chain issues.
Commercial Demand Gains, but Cutting and Welding Exit Continues
Commercial-market revenue, including industrial and microfabrication sales, increased 20% year over year to $25.3 million. Microfabrication revenue was $13.3 million, while industrial revenue was $12 million.
Industrial results benefited from higher demand for additive-manufacturing products and sales related to last-time purchases of cutting and welding products. nLight is exiting its legacy cutting and welding markets and does not expect material revenue from those markets in the second half of 2026.
Management said additive manufacturing demand has been strong, including demand associated with rocket engines and a broader range of aerospace and defense components. Keeney also said the company sees accelerating needs for laser sensing and advanced-manufacturing products in the space sector, although he did not provide further details on specific programs.
Margins Improve From Prior Year
Total gross margin was 31.1%, compared with 29.9% a year earlier, though down from 33.1% in the first quarter. Product gross margin increased year over year to 41.2%, aided by sales mix and higher production volumes that improved absorption of fixed manufacturing costs. Development gross margin was 5.6%, compared with 13.1% a year earlier, reflecting contract mix and the timing of program deliverables.
On a GAAP basis, nLight posted a net loss of $1.3 million, or $0.02 per share, improving from a $3.6 million loss a year earlier. Non-GAAP net income was $9.6 million, or $0.15 per diluted share, versus $2.9 million, or $0.06 per share, in the prior-year quarter.
The company ended the quarter with $330.8 million in cash equivalents, restricted cash and investments. It also repaid the $20 million previously drawn on its credit line.
China Supply Constraints Weigh on Third-Quarter Outlook
For the third quarter, nLight forecast revenue of $63 million to $73 million, with a midpoint of $68 million. The midpoint includes about $43 million of product revenue and $25 million of development revenue.
Corso said the outlook excludes roughly $17 million in product revenue that the company otherwise expected to ship during the quarter. Those deliveries are now expected in future periods because nLight is experiencing delays obtaining certain parts and materials from Chinese suppliers.
Keeney said the affected materials primarily include optics and are not specialized components, but China has developed an outsized role in that supply chain. The issue is mainly affecting commercial products, although management acknowledged some indirect exposure in defense products because certain commercial items are incorporated into defense offerings.
The company said it has been reducing its China exposure by moving manufacturing out of the country, working with existing suppliers, qualifying new suppliers and considering product redesigns that could provide greater sourcing flexibility. Corso said the issue emerged only in recent weeks and could resolve quickly or persist for months to quarters depending on mitigation efforts.
nLight expects third-quarter gross margin of 24% to 30% and adjusted EBITDA of $1 million to $7 million. Management said the broader-than-usual revenue guidance range is exclusively related to the supply-chain uncertainty.
About nLight (NASDAQ:LASR)
nLIGHT, Inc designs, develops, manufactures, and sells semiconductor and fiber lasers for industrial, microfabrication, and aerospace and defense applications. The company operates in two segments, Laser Products and Advanced Development. It offers semiconductor lasers with various ranges of power levels, wavelengths, and output fiber sizes; and programmable and serviceable fiber lasers for use in industrial and aerospace and defense applications. The company also provides laser sensors, including light detection and ranging technologies for intelligence, surveillance, and reconnaissance applications; and fiber amplifiers, beam combination, and control systems for use in high-energy laser systems in directed energy applications.
